Brave always crashes when returning to a Matlab session that you've just restored

Description of the issue:
When using the online (browser based) version of Matlab, if you leave a Matlab session unused for a certain amount of time (maybe 10 minutes? I am not sure exactly how long) then Matlab will disable the session and you will have have to click on the Restore Session button in a dialog that opens up. The session restores, but then attempting any interaction with the Command Window (for example just hit enter) will cause Brave to freeze for 2-3 seconds, after which it crashes (all brave windows close and Brave restarts).

Steps to Reproduce (add as many as necessary):

  1. Start a Matlab session online.
  2. In the command window type a few commands (like ls, and pwd for example).
  3. Leave the session open until it expires and a Session Timeout dialog box pops up.
  4. Wait until the 90 seconds timer on the dialog box expires. (Do not click on the Continue Working button).
  5. The contents of the dialog box now will say that your session has timed out and it will show 2 buttons, one of which is Resume.
  6. Click on the Resume button.
  7. Click on the Command Window to bring the focus to it. The cursor on the command prompt should start blinking.
  8. Type anything, for example type ls and hit enter.

Actual Result (gifs and screenshots are welcome!):
Brave will crash.

Expected result:
Brave should not crash.

Reproduces how often:

Brave Version(about:brave):
Version 0.60.48 Chromium: 72.0.3626.121 (Official Build) (64-bit)

Reproducible on current live release (yes/no):

Additional Information:
Once Brave restarts the Matlab session reopens, and works (you can type stuff and it doesn’t crash until the next time it times out and gets restored).

